Canada Flight Supplement [CFS]Paulatuk is a hamlet located in the
Inuvik Region of theNorthwest Territories ,Canada . It is located adjacent toDarnley Bay , in theAmundsen Gulf . The town was named for the coal that was found in the area in the 1920s, and theSiglitun spelling is "Paulatuuq", "place of coal".Demographics
Paulatuk, as of the 2006 Census, had a population of 294, of these, 265 were
Inuit (Inuvialuit ). The two principal languages spoken in Paulatuk areInuvialuktun and English. The community is situated on
Letty Harbour and was settled in the 1920s. This was followed a few years later by theRoman Catholic Church which opened atrading post . In the 1950s aDistant Early Warning Line site was built about 95 km (59 mi) to the northeast atCape Parry , on theParry Peninsula , providing a wage based income for the community. The trading post was taken over by the local co-op and today the local store is part ofThe North West Company .Northwestel]Hunting ,fishing and trapping are major economic activities, but in recent years art printmaking has played an increasing role in the local economy.The
Smoking Hills which are about 105 km (65 mi) west on the shores of theArctic Ocean are a scientifically interesting object, since they are diminishing thepH value of the water areas. So the buffer effect has completely disappeared. Located to the east of the community isTuktut Nogait National Park andParks Canada has an office in the community.ervices
Services include a two member
Royal Canadian Mounted Police detachment and a health centre with twonurse s. [http://www.stats.gov.nt.ca/Infrastructure/Inf_Profiles/Paulatuk(i).pdf Infrastructure] ] Phone services are provided byNorthwestel with Internet bySSI Micro and their AirWare service. [ [http://www.airware.ca/?page_id=6 AirWare] ]The community is part of the
Beaufort Delta Education Council [ [http://www.bdec.nt.ca/ BEDC] ] and schooling is available up to Grade 11 at the Angik School. [ [http://www.bdec.nt.ca/bsite/angik/ Angik School] ] There is also a community learning centre operated byAurora College .The community is not accessible by road but there is a airport,
Paulatuk Airport , and flights into the community are provided byAklak Air from Inuvik three times a week. [ [http://www.aklakair.ca/scheds/AklakAir_Winter_Schedule.pdf Aklak Air schedule] ] In the summerfloatplane s can use thePaulatuk Water Aerodrome and an annualsealift is provided byNorthern Transportation Company Limited from Hay River.
